WebOn Aug. 21st during the Great American Solar Eclipse, the students of Earth to Sky Calculus launched 11 space weather balloons from the path of totality. They aimed to photograph the Moon's shadow from the stratosphere--and they succeeded. WebJun 4, 2016 · Based in Bishop, California, Earth to Sky Calculus members let loose their sky-high experiments at an altitude of 8,500 feet in the Eastern Sierra mountain range. Landing sites for parachuting payloads are typically located 10 miles to 70 miles away in the Death Valley National Park, White Mountains, and the Inyo Mountain range of California.
